    It sounds like you wish to change the passphrase that your disk is encrypted to?

    Are you using the Single Sign On (SSO) option where you enter the passphrase only once, and boot directly into your Windows User account?  If so, from within Windows, use Ctrl-Alt-Delete to change the passphrase.

    If you are using an eToken or Smartcard because your disk is encrypted to a public key, you need to change the PIN for the eToken or Smartcard.

    If the disk is encrypted directly to a passphrase instead of a Key and the above SSO is not used, launch PGP Desktop, click on the PGP Disk control module on the left, and then click on the User on the lower part of the right side, and then select Change Passphrase.
